Chapter One: Introduction

1.1 Background of the Study
Political corruption has long been a challenge for many democratic processes, undermining the legitimacy and effectiveness of electoral systems. In Nigeria, corruption during elections manifests in various forms, including vote-buying, ballot-box stuffing, and manipulation of results. Damaturu Local Government in Yobe State has witnessed instances of political corruption that have affected the credibility of elections. This study will examine the relationship between political corruption and electoral processes in Damaturu, focusing on how corrupt practices undermine the integrity of elections and erode public trust in the political system (Ali & Lawan, 2024).

1.2 Statement of the Problem
Corruption within the electoral process is a significant barrier to free and fair elections in Nigeria, particularly in local governments like Damaturu. Instances of vote-buying, manipulation of electoral outcomes, and other corrupt practices hinder the credibility of elections and reduce voter confidence. While there has been substantial attention given to electoral reform at the national level, local governments continue to be plagued by corruption. This study will assess how political corruption affects the electoral processes in Damaturu Local Government and explore the broader implications for democratic governance in Nigeria (Bala & Aminu, 2023).

1.8 Operational Definition of Terms

  • Political Corruption: Illegal or unethical practices by politicians or government officials to gain or maintain power, including vote-buying, election rigging, and bribery.
  • Electoral Integrity: The degree to which an electoral process is free, fair, transparent, and accountable to the electorate.
  • Democratic Governance: A political system where leaders are elected through free and fair elections and are held accountable to the electorate.
